Ecological Consultant

Ecological Consultant. An Edinburgh based environmental consulting firm are looking for an Ecological Consultant to join the team. The Ecological Consultant role will include a requirement to assist with business generation, project management and mentoring of junior staff. The Ecological Consultant should be members of, or working towards membership of the CIEEM or an equivalent professional body.

The Ecological Consultant will:

To provide a high standard of scoping, survey design, survey capability and factual, interpretative, advisory, Ecological Impact Assessment and legal reporting output, adhering to deadlines and working in a safe, accurate, timely and effective manner.
To deliver ecological surveys to a high standard
To ensure compliance with Health and Safety requirements at all times
To act as Project Manager for projects awarded to the company.
To provide specialist site based support to clients through delivery of ECoW role
To effectively manage sub-contractors and to quality check that the work and deliverables are undertaken/provided to the standard required.
To mentor junior members of staff where required to do so.
To play an active part in attracting new clients and generating new business for the company.
To operate in compliance with the Staff Handbook, appropriate Code(s) of Professional Conduct and with strict regard to relevant legal requirements.
To continue to develop professionally and to make a positive contribution to the overall performance of the Company.

The Ecological Consultant core duties will be:

To undertake ecological surveys, site visits, site meetings and ECoW role as required, recording to a high technical standard as well as generating relevant plans and reports such as extended phase 1 reports, NVC reports, habitat management plans, construction environmental management plans, site waste management plans, peat management plans etc.
To perform the role of Project Manager for projects. These are likely to be small to medium in size but may also include larger more complex projects where required. The post holder will increasingly take responsibility for directing their own projects, but will always be able to draw upon support provided by the Senior Ecologist/ Principal Environmental Consultant/ Technical Director/ Director who is named in the proposal as the person responsible for technical direction of that particular project as well as the wider team.
To continue to develop responsibility for reducing risks and minimising liability. Including, in particular, being responsible for both personal and the team's health and safety through ensuring that the projects for which the Consultant is manager comply with Health & Safety Procedures, and ensuring that the team on any project for which the Consultant is the Project Manager complies with the ISO 9001 Quality Management System.
To practice strict budgetary discipline, in particular by ensuring that the scope of work and the time available is clearly understood and communicated to the project team before commencing work on any given task. To draw upon the support available from both Line Manager and Team providing technical direction in respect of any project for which the Ecological Consultant is manager, by adequate planning and monitoring of the project workload and budgets to ensure that there is no avoidable overspend.
To become entirely confident with legislation pertaining to nature conservation, able to apply it to projects and negotiate subtleties with third parties, including planning authorities and statutory agencies.
To produce accurate and well-presented factual baseline, interpretative, advisory, legal compliance and Ecological Impact Assessment reports and EIA's, demonstrating an excellent standard of written English and a high level of competence in using Word.
To contribute to marketing activities, e.g. marketing campaigns and materials, press releases, snippets for website, twitter, articles, identification and attendance at suitable conferences and exhibitions, etc.
To increasingly attract new clients and generate new business for the company, not just by reactively writing tenders/proposals, but also by proactively identifying and contacting prospective clients in accordance with priorities set out in the Business Plan and/or as agreed with their Line Manager.
To work with their Line Manager to agree personal professional development objectives and identify training courses to attend and other activities to undertake as part of his/her Continuing Professional Development.
The Ecological Consultant will need suitable recent relevant experience.

The Ecological Consultant starting salary is £28k + benefits
